Ok, I have been making my salsa for a couple years now... but everytime someone else tries to make it is disgusting. Seriously so I will give you mine but I am not responsible if you dont like the outcome. It is so simple.
1 large can (yes I use canned) tomatos,
one medium yellow onion,
about 1/8 cup of a diced red/purple onion,
1/2 jalapeno,
1-2 cloves FRESH minced garlic, and about half of a bunch of fresh cilantro.
I love cilantro so we use a lot. and then just garlic salt and lime juice to taste. IF you like salsa that is more like pico de gallo then drain the tomatos, if you like restaraunt style salsa, dont drain them. If you try it be sure and let me know how it turns out.

Cranberry Salsa
12 oz. bag of fresh cranberries
1 - granny smith apple
1/2 - red pepper
1/2 - red onion
3 Tbs. - fresh cilantro
1 medium jalapeno, seeds removed
3/4 c. - sugar
1/3 c. - apple juice

Place all in a food processor and pulse until all is well chopped.
Enjoy with chips.
This is also great with turkey or ham
(You can also put the whole red pepper in... just adjust to your taste)
